Your Responsibilities
As a Litigation Administrator for John Deere Financial working remotely or at our Worldwide Headquarters located in Johnston, Iowa, you will research and determine strategic business objectives on incoming litigation accounts. You will incorporate market and financial product knowledge, equipment valuations and unique customer, channel situations to execute reasoned litigation strategies. The matter types will include all bankruptcy chapters, replevins (involuntary repossessions) and other matters as assigned. Strategies include leveraging mediation, filing lawsuits, bankruptcy restructuring and other workout remedies which result in mitigating financial loss. This position works on accounts for all U.S. JDF financial products and customer segments in an assigned geographical area. This role requires working independently and collaboratively with local attorneys to achieve enterprise objectives. You will attend and participate in legal proceedings, both virtually and in-person, while working under tight timelines. Additionally, you will:
Determine and direct a reasoned business strategy in conjunction with leveraging legal opinion from JDF in-house counsel and/or by directing and collaborating with local counsel resulting in cost-effective outcomes
Develop and further strategic relationships with team members, local counsel, dealers, sales personnel, business units, and senior management
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ather necessary information and insights, ensuring a comprehensive understanding of complex financial situations
Research, incorporate and communicate strategy impacted by equipment fair market value evaluations through JDF Asset Remarketing, John Deere Dealers, or third parties
Review, approve, and sign legal documents (complaints, affidavits, etc.) to be filed in court action supporting matter strategy; review, prepare and approve discovery requests associated with adverse litigation matters
Attend and effectively speak at mediations, depositions and/ or be deposed and testify at hearings or trials
Effectively communicate legal spend, matter strategy, market trends and dealer feedback to management, in-house counsel, channel partners, sales personnel, business units and applicable stakeholders
Evaluate and document the performance of local counsel to ensure compliance with established standards and business objectives, including recommendations to management and JDF in-house counsel on the continued use and/or termination

What Makes You Stand Out
Strong understanding of Artificial Intelligence (AI) and hands-on experience using Microsoft Copilot to enhance productivity and innovation
Knowledge of equipment (Turf / Agriculture / Construction / Forestry) and understanding of use seasons and depreciation
Experience with analyzing financials, cash flow, credit reports, etc. to assess collectability
Understanding of legal terminology, documents, court procedures and litigation processes
Understanding of federal and state laws relating to bankruptcy and repossession
Understanding of the Uniform Commercial Code (UCC) - Revised Article 9
